The SA58646 is a BiCMOS integrated circuit that performs all functions from the antenna
to the microcontroller for reception and transmission for both the base station and the
handset in a 902 MHz to 928 MHz full-duplex radio. The SA58646 may be used in a UHF
push-to-talk walkie-talkie or in a UHF to 900 MHz data transceiver. The SA58646 is a
pin-compatible derivative of the UAA3515 with advanced features.
This IC integrates most of the functions required for a half-duplex or full-duplex radio in a
single integrated circuit. Additionally, the programmability implemented reduces
significantly external components count, board space requirements and external
adjustments.

Integrated LNA
Image reject mixer
FM detector at 10.7 MHz including an IF limiter, a wide band PLL demodulator, an
output amplifier and a RSSI output
Carrier detection with programmable threshold
Programmable data amplifier (slicer) phase
Crystal reference oscillator with integrated tuning capacitor
Reference frequency divider
Narrow band RX PLL including RX VCO with integrated varicaps
Narrow band TX PLL including TX VCO with integrated varicaps
VCO external inductors can be done with printed transmission lines on the PCB
which offers substantial savings
Programmable clock divider with output buffer to drive a microcontroller
Programmable RX gain (enable phone volume control)
Expander with output noise level control
Earpiece amplifier with volume control feature
Data amplifier
Microphone amplifier
Compressor with automatic level control and hard limiter
Programmable TX gain

... MHz crystal frequency is proposed. The clock divider value will be programmed 2.5, 4 and 128. The clock divider value of 128 is chosen to place the SA58646 in Sleep mode which enables current saving in the microcontroller. The clock output is an emitter follower type. The 16-bit TX counter is programmed for the desired transmit channel frequency. The 16-bit RX counter is programmed for the desired local oscillator frequency ...
